White Riot Continue To Falter

White Riot 9-15 Partizan DVLA

Despite a very promising start to the game,White Riot fell to yet another defeat. For the first 10 minutes of the game, Partizan DVLA barely touched the ball as White Riot built a two goal lead, which would have been more had it not been for a combination of poor finishing and great goal keeping. When the first round of subs came however, White Riot lost their stranglehold on the game as Partizan played their way back into contention. Poor defending and great finishing ensured that Partizan built up a 5 goal cushion by half time. When Robert Kinsey, Geraint Havard, Aled Rees and Stephen Sypliwtchak were re-united on the field, White Riot fought back to within two goals, despite not having the same stranglehold on the game that they previously had, before the next round of substitutions saw the game again slip away from White Riot. A dejected Geraint Havard said after the game, "I'm not pointing fingers at anyone on the field, but that defeat was against the worst team the we have played at Play Football's Sunday Premiership. We showed early on that we could dominate as we starved them of possession, but again we have thrown a game away against a team we should really be hammering."
